Output d1736a1ea7988e626bca238ab4bb9970c06b30d2edeb140457d9afbbad236686:1

value
999733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8abea5f97e79c4ed745471d1d96dd5f32e8e140 OP_EQUAL
address
3QMsT1yB19cesja1vkisfUbUbt51FVsyST
transaction
d1736a1ea7988e626bca238ab4bb9970c06b30d2edeb140457d9afbbad236686
confirmations
332613
spent
true